A rural bike ride near Long Parish and Whitchurch, Hampshire

Last weekend I was lucky enough to be able to find time to make the most of the dry but cold weather, and took the opportunity for a bike ride down to Whitchurch in Hampshire. I've cycled this route, or more accurately a slightly off road version of it, before but as always each visit reveals new things. The first revelation was a little sad, and that was of yet another closed pub. A couple of summers ago I stopped here mid bike ride for lunch and a pint at the Hurstbourne Inn, in Hurstbourne Priors, but alas those days would now seem to be gone. I also noticed that The Coronation Arms in St. Marybourne had also closed.

As my ride continued, I came across more relics of a bygone ear, although these buttresses which supported the bridge carrying the railway line south from Whitchurch towards Winchester would have been closed to business several decades earlier than the pub above.

Whitchurch itself is probably about two thirds, or 20 miles, of the way around this particular loop and I'm always pleased to arrive and treat myself to a coffee, and sometimes a cake, at H's. The next two pictures are of the White Hart which I'm pleased to say is still open and sits proudly opposite H's, as I sat on the bench outside the café, sipping my takeaway Americano.
